Strawberry Kiss Cookies Recipe

  • Author: Julia
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 12 minutes
  • Total Time: 48 minutes
  • Yield: 18 cookies
  • Category: Dessert
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American

Description

Strawberry Kiss Cookies are a delightful soft sugar cookie treat perfect for Valentine’s Day, featuring a tender cream cheese dough coated in pink or white sanding sugar and topped with a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kiss for a melt-in-your-mouth finish.


Ingredients

Scale

Cookie Dough

  • 1 (16 oz) bag Funfetti sugar cookie mix
  • 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 large egg

Coating & Topping

  • ½ cup p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ils
  • 18 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kisses


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per to prevent sticking and ensure easy cleanup.
  2. Make Dough: In a large bowl, mix together the Funfetti sugar cookie mix, softened cream cheese, and egg until a soft dough forms with no dry spots.
  3. Prepare Coating: Place the p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ils into a shallow bowl for easy rolling of the cookie dough balls.
  4. Form Cookie Balls: Using a 1½ tablespoon scoop, scoop out dough portions, roll each in the sanding sugar or non-pareils to coat, and shape them into smooth, round balls.
  5. Chill if Sticky: If the dough feels too sticky to handle, chill it in the refrigerator for 30 to 60 minutes to firm up for easier rolling.
  6. Arrange on Baking Sheet: Place the coated cookie dough balls on the prepared baking sheet about 1½ inches apart to allow spreading while baking.
  7. Bake Cookies: Bake in the preheated oven for 12 minutes until the edges are set but the centers remain soft and tender.
  8. Add Kisses: After baking, let the cookies cool for 3 to 5 minutes on the baking sheet, then gently press one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kiss into the center of each cookie.
  9. Cool or Serve Warm: Allow the cookies to cool completely to set the chocolate or enjoy them warm with a soft, melting center.

Notes

  • Use room temperature cream cheese to ensure the dough mixes smoothly without lumps.
  • If the dough is sticky, chill it to make handling easier and coat hands with sanding sugar to prevent sticking.
  • For firmer and defined strawberry kiss centers, let cookies cool slightly before pressing the Kisses in.
  • If you prefer a soft, melted strawberry kiss center, press the Kisses into the cookies immediately after removal from the oven.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 cookie
  • Calories: 150 kcal
  • Sugar: 12 g
  • Sodium: 130 mg
  • Fat: 7 g
  • Saturated Fat: 4 g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 2 g
  • Trans Fat: 0 g
  • Carbohydrates: 20 g
  • Fiber: 1 g
  • Protein: 2 g
  • Cholesterol: 25 mg
